Science Fair

Big shout-out to Parkridge Medical Center for hosting our second annual Science Fair! There were 12 booth total, along with the ambulance outside, for our 3-5 grade students to learn all about their bodies and the health care industry.

Booth #1 Medical Laboratory Professionals
Study of blood parasites and diseases
 
Booth #2 Germs
Students learn the proper way to apply hand sanitizer to effectively eradicate germs.

Booth #3 Food Guide Pyramid
Students learned a new way to create a healthy plate. Visit Choose My Plate.gov to learn more!

 Students practiced making healthy choices with what they put on their plate.


Booth #4 Fats and Sugars
By far the most disgusting booth, and the most informative.  Students received a visual as to how much fats and sugars can be found in their meals and candy.
 The different vials contain sugar in the gram amounts that is found in cereals, drinks, and other popular foods.
This is 5 pounds of fat. Lovely, isn't it?

Booth #5 Heart Rate
Students learned how to track their resting and accelerated heart rates.
 If you look at the Food Guide Pyramid closely, you'll see that on the side there is a person climbing a staircase. This is to remind us that eating right is nothing without physical exercise. Get up, get out, and exercise!

Booth #6 Blood Pressure
Parkridge made sure to not test the teachers, only the students. :)



 Booth #7 Cardiovascular
Students learned about the functions of the heart, the different chambers, and looked at an Echocardiogram of a heartbeat.


Booth #8 MRI (Magnetic Resonance Imaging)
The Students learned all about the nervous system in the brain  and how doctors used the MRI to find malfunctioning areas of the body.

 
 Booth # 9 Radiation
Student learned what could make them GLOW! The techs explained about radiation, what machine to use to find out if they were exposed to radiation, and the effects of radiation on the human body.

Booth # 10 Life Cycle
Student were able to view and study the life cycle of a frog on a computer.


Booth # 11 Choking
Student were taught how to recognize when someone was choking, how to help that person safely and correctly with the Heimlich maneuver.



 Booth #12 Career in  Healthcare
The presenters taught about the different career available in the health care industry and what each student needed to do while in elementary school to achieve that career goal.
